You can find more castles outside the parks , including at Disney ’ s Old Key West , which is home to a massive sand castle — the type of castle that seems like it truly belongs in Florida . Head to the pool to see this marvel and take a 125-foot-long waterslide through the structure .
When Blizzard Beach reopened after its 2021 refurbishment , it featured some Frozen-themed additions , such as Anna and Elsa ’ s igloo castle at Tike ’ s Peak . Created for children under 4 feet tall , the igloo castle has figures of child versions of Anna and Elsa . The fortress also has play features like pop-up water jets . Although this fortress may be simple compared to the more intricate and detailed castles in the theme parks , it easily captures the imagination of small children .

Then there are the fantastical castles — one made of “ snow ” and “ ice ” and one made of “ sand ” — at Winter Summerland Miniature Golf . They ' re part of two 18- hole mini golf courses . The golf courses are near the entrance to Blizzard Beach , so you may have time to visit the Blizzard Beach castle and the mini golf castles all in one day .
